Transaction 08392306306bc54e6004bd603118d9e6f2e9d030fccfc09615e77deb48496a1b
1 Input
1 Output
-
08392306306bc54e6004bd603118d9e6f2e9d030fccfc09615e77deb48496a1b:0
- value
- 143253
- script pubkey
- OP_0 OP_PUSHBYTES_20 42e8b541c336a096ccc3edf26a5e22b04f47dd6e
- address
- bc1qgt5t2swrx6sfdnxrahex5h3zkp850htw9w2rrf